Abstract
A steel structure ski jump platform steel plate basement slideway snow fixing construction structure belongs to the technical field of snow sport project infrastructure construction. The snow-fixing net comprises a steel plate base, a dewatering plate, a stainless steel internal thread sleeve, a snow body, a snow-fixing net drawknot plate, a slotted flat-end fastening screw, a large hexagon nut, a spring washer, a U-shaped clamp pin shaft, a snow-fixing net top rope buckle, a snow-fixing net and a drawknot rope. Through drilling a through hole on a steel plate substrate, welding a stainless steel internal thread sleeve on the steel plate substrate, screwing a slotted flat end fastening screw into the stainless steel internal thread sleeve, laying a bonded hydrophobic plate by using bonding glue, mounting a snow fixing net drawknot plate on the screw, fixing the snow fixing net drawknot plate by using a large hexagon nut and a spring washer, and fixing a rope buckle at the top end of the snow fixing net by using a U-shaped clamp. Description
Technical Field
The invention belongs to the technical field of construction of snow sports project infrastructures, and particularly provides a steel structure ski jump platform steel plate base slideway snow fixing construction structure which is suitable for fixing snow bodies of the steel structure ski jump platform steel plate base slideway.
Background
The only formal ski-jump stage venue in the main city area of Beijing of the skiing jump stage is also the ski-jump stage venue permanently reserved at the head of the world. In the past, most of ski jumps are made and fixed on the natural mountain after being shaped. The main body structure of the first steel skiing big diving platform is an all-steel structure, the base of the track is a steel plate, and the problem of how to fix snow on the steel plate is a brand-new challenge.
Disclosure of Invention
The invention aims to provide a steel structure ski jump platform steel plate base slideway snow fixing construction structure, which solves the problem of snow fixing of a steel plate base and realizes the snow body fixing of the steel plate base slideway on the all-steel structure snowfield. The device is suitable for fixing the snow body based on the steel plate substrate slideway.
According to the invention, through holes are drilled on a steel plate substrate, then a stainless steel internal thread sleeve is welded on the steel plate substrate, a slotted flat end fastening screw is screwed into the stainless steel internal thread sleeve, a hydrophobic plate is laid and bonded by bonding glue, then a snow fixing net drawknot plate is arranged on the screw and fixed by a large hexagon nut and a spring washer, then a U-shaped clamp is used for fixing a rope buckle at the top end of the snow fixing net, a drawknot rope is used for fixing the middle part of the snow fixing net, and after the snow fixing net is arranged and fixed, snow is made and fixed, so that the snow body is fixed. The method solves the problem of snow body fixation of the steel plate substrate, and realizes snow body fixation of the steel plate substrate slideway of the all-steel structure snowfield project.
The snow-fixing net comprises a steel plate substrate 1, a hydrophobic plate 2, a stainless steel internal thread sleeve 3, a snow body 4, a snow-fixing net drawknot plate 5, a slotted flat-end fastening screw 6, a large hexagon nut 7, a spring washer 8, a U-shaped clamp 9, a U-shaped clamp pin shaft 10, a snow-fixing net top rope buckle 11, a snow-fixing net 12 and a drawknot rope 13. Drilling a through hole on the steel plate substrate 1 and chamfering the upper edge of the hole; the stainless steel internal thread sleeve 3 is inserted into the drilled through hole on the steel plate substrate 1, the upper end of the drilled through hole is aligned with the upper surface of the steel plate, and the stainless steel internal thread sleeve is fixed by welding seam girth welding; screwing the slotted flat-end set screw 6 into the stainless steel internal thread sleeve 3; bonding and paving the hydrophobic plate 2 by using bonding glue; installing the snow-fixing net drawknot plate 5 on the slotted flat-end set screw 6 and fixing the same by using a large hexagon nut 7 and a spring washer 8; fixing a rope buckle 11 at the top of the snow fixing net on the knot tying plate 5 of the snow fixing net by using a U-shaped clamp 9 and a U-shaped clamp pin shaft 10; one end of a tying rope 13 is tied and fixed on the snow fixing net 12, and the other end of the tying rope passes through a pin shaft hole of the snow fixing net tying plate 5 and is tied and fixed on the snow fixing net 12 at the symmetrical position of the other end; after the snow fixing net 12 is installed and fixed, snow is made, and the snow body 4 is fixed.
The snow-fixing net drawknot plate 5 is fixed on the steel plate substrate 1 by a slotted flat-end fastening screw 6, a large hexagon nut 7 and a spring washer 8 and the hydrophobic plate 2 is compacted and fixed by the snow-fixing net drawknot plate 5 by welding the stainless steel internal thread sleeve 3 on the steel plate substrate 1.
The snow-fixing net drawknot plate is formed by combining and applying a steel plate substrate 1, a hydrophobic plate 2, a stainless steel internal thread sleeve 3, a snow-fixing net drawknot plate 5, a slotted flat-end fastening screw 6, a large hexagon nut 7, a spring washer 8, a U-shaped clamp 9, a U-shaped clamp pin shaft 10, a snow-fixing net top rope buckle 11, a snow-fixing net 12 and a drawknot rope 13, fixing of the snow-fixing net drawknot plate is realized through matching and switching of the internal thread sleeve and the screw, and fixing of the snow-fixing net and the snow-fixing net drawknot plate is realized through a U-shaped shackle and the drawknot rope, so that fixing of a slideway snow body of the steel plate substrate is guaranteed. The concrete construction steps are as follows:
1. a through hole is drilled in the steel plate substrate 1 and chamfered at the upper edge of the hole.
2. And (3) penetrating the stainless steel internal thread sleeve 3 into the drilled through hole on the steel plate substrate 1, aligning the upper end with the upper surface of the steel plate and fixing by welding seam girth welding.
3. The slotted flat set screw 6 is screwed into the stainless steel internally threaded sleeve 3.
4. The bonded hydrophobic plate 2 is laid with bonding glue.
5. The snow-fixing net drawknot plate 5 is arranged on a slotted flat-end set screw 6 and fixed by a large hexagon nut 7 and a spring washer 8.
6. And a rope buckle 11 at the top of the snow fixing net is fixed on the knot pulling plate 5 of the snow fixing net by a U-shaped clamp 9 and a U-shaped clamp pin shaft 10.
7. One end of a tying rope 13 is tied and fixed on the snow fixing net 12, and the other end of the tying rope passes through a pin shaft hole of the snow fixing net tying plate 5 and is tied and fixed on the snow fixing net 12 at the symmetrical position of the other end.
8. After the snow fixing net 12 is installed and fixed, snow is made, and the snow body 4 is fixed.
